6-amino-1H-pyrimidin-2-one
Also Known As: cytosine, Cytosinimine, 4-Amino-2-hydroxypyrimidine, 6-Aminopyrimidin-2(1h)-One, 4-aminopyrimidin-2(1H)-one

| Molecular Formula | C4H5N3O |
| Molecular Weight | 111.04326 g/mol |
| XLogP | -1.7 |
|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) | 67.5 Ų |
| Hydrogen Bond Donors | 2 |
| Hydrogen Bond Acceptors | 2 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 0 |
| Exact Mass | 111.04326 Da |
| Heavy Atoms | 8 |
| Complexity | 170.0 |
| Melting Point | > 300 °C |
| Vapor Pressure | 0.00109 [mmHg] |
| Solubility | 8.0 mg/mL |
| SMILES | C1=C(NC(=O)N=C1)N |
| InChIKey | OPTASPLRGRRNAP-UHFFFAOYSA-N |

The XLogP value of -1.7 indicates that Cytosine is hydrophilic (water-soluble), making it suitable for aqueous formulations and biological assay applications. The TPSA of 67.5 Ų falls within the moderate polarity range, balancing permeability and solubility for Cytosine. Following Lipinski's Rule of Five, Cytosine has 2 hydrogen bond donor(s) and 2 hydrogen bond acceptor(s), all within the drug-like range, suggesting favorable oral bioavailability potential.
